I decided that I needed gloves with more padding and that was when I stumbled upon the Fox Ranger Gel gloves, and after using them I doubt I will ever ride in any other glove again.

Fox Ranger Gel gloves have several strategically placed TRUGEL gel inserts to reduce pressure and impacts on the ulnar and radial nerves. They feature a double layer palm and padded knuckles for durability and protection and are available in either full finger coverage or short finger length. They have a compression moulded cuff with a hook and loop closure. The thumb and index finger are touchscreen compatible, and they also feature an absorbent sweat wipe on the thumb and have silicone fingertip printing. They're made out of a 4-way stretch polyester material.
Fox Ranger Gel gloves come in a variety of colours to suit any taste, including black/charcoal, fluro yellow, ice blue, red, teal and dark green, and they come in a range of sizes from small to extra large. Although they are not technically a women’s specific glove, I had no trouble comfortably fitting a small size glove.
I generally don’t like to wear gloves that have hook and loop closures as I find they tend to rub on my wrists, which annoys me, but I've had no issues with these gloves rubbing and I find the closure well fitting and comfortable. At first, I found that the raised finger and gel pads felt weird on my grips but after a few minutes I completely forgot about it and no longer noticed them. With the gel grips, I can grip my handlebars more comfortably and actually feel more in control of my bike, especially over the rough and rocky technical terrain that I frequently ride on. I can ride for hours and not have sore hands or blisters at the end of each ride.
I thoroughly recommend these Fox Ranger Gel gloves; they are extremely comfortable, fit really well, great value for money, hard wearing, and alleviate sore hands whilst riding. After trying these gloves I will never go back to using non-padded gloves again.
